WiredTree Strengthens the Network with Noction Intelligent Routing Platform

Chicaco, IL (PRWEB) June 12, 2012

Noction Intelligent Routing Platform (IRP) constantly checks traffic on WiredTree network edge and reroutes connections over existing Tier-1 backbone providers to get the lowest possible latency.

The WiredTree network consists of two logically separate and redundant architectures separate networks: a public Internet network and a private internal network. The public Internet network connects client servers to the Internet at high-speeds. The private internal network is not reachable from the public Internet. It enables WiredTree to provide many services not available at other providers including CDP and Backup Services, SAN storage, local DNS resolvers, OS update servers, service monitoring, and performance metrics. The private network also allows for free secure server to server communication without using any of the public bandwidth allowance. WiredTree partners with world class, Tier-1 providers to deliver high-performance connectivity to customers.

Most networks assume that since they have top-tier providers, they dont have persistent performance problems. In reality, most are experiencing lots of important network events a day that go unsolved because they fall below of being total outages, and they are happening too quickly to effectively troubleshoot and react to, said Grigore Raileanu, Noction President. Running IRP means identify problem areas outside of your network, before end users notice, and automatically solve them.

IRP enhances network performance by an average of 10-40% and reduces latency by approximately 30%. It improves network stability and reduces downtime, increases operational efficiency by automating network troubleshooting and problem resolution, also providing better network management and planning.

Logicalis Strengthens Award-Winning Cloud Consulting Practice


Farmington Hills, MI (PRWEB) September 11, 2012

Data storage, maintenance and access are critical components in every business today driving public and private cloud adoption. Logicalis, an international IT solutions and managed services provider, today announced enhancements to its cloud consulting and hosted services practice that will continue to help IT pros define individualized cloud paths that are tailored specifically to the needs of their businesses.

The adoption of cloud computing promises to help organizations lower IT operational complexity, reduce IT operational costs, increase speed of IT services deployment and help IT and, therefore, business agility. But this is a complex arena, according to Robert Mahowald, research vice president for SaaS and Cloud Services at IDC. “Data from IDC’s 2012 CloudTrack survey suggests that cloud providers need to work with their customers to design and plan thoroughly, and delineate all their underlying operational processes and systems via workshops, and then continue to provide them with guidance and consultancy as their business requirements change.

And that is exactly what Logicalis is doing. Logicalis offers detailed cloud readiness, cloud design, and data center assessments to help its clients define their individual paths to the cloud that will best augment their unique business strategies. At Logicalis, were introducing an IT cloud consulting practice, expanding our hosted cloud services, and adding private cloud solutions that feature technologies from industry-leading vendors, says Mike Martin, vice president, Cloud Solutions, for Logicalis.

Recent Enhancements to Logicalis Cloud Practice

1. The addition of VMwares VSphere 5, vCloud Director and Site Recovery Manager to Logicalis cloud platform expands clients virtualized data center strategies while simultaneously stretching CIOs computing budgets.

2. The recent addition of CA Technologies Automation Suite for Clouds enables clients to simplify the consumption and management of Logicalis IT and infrastructure cloud services.

3. An enhanced storage strategy that includes NetApp, in addition to IBM, and provides an expanded cloud reference platform supporting Logicalis own hosted cloud services the Logicalis Enterprise Cloud. The inclusion of NetApp provides integrated storage solutions that round out Logicalis FlexPod practice with Cisco.

4. Expanded storage services include EMC Data Domain for backup, archiving, and disaster recovery in Logicalis hosted cloud.

5. Logicalis is launching a new customer self-service IT cloud portal based on Cisco Intelligent Automation software.

6. Logicalis has earned the Cisco Cloud Builder designation within the Cisco Cloud Partner Program, a designation that recognizes Logicalis competencies to sell and implement Cisco end to-end cloud solutions for its customers.

7.Logicalis, an IBM Premier partner, is one of very few partners to have earned certification in both the Cloud Builder and Cloud Infrastructure solution areas of IBMs Cloud Specialty program.

8. To help customers visualize how any proposed cloud solution might impact their business, Logicalis has created two Cloud Centers of Excellence demo centers based on the HP CloudSystem Matrix one in Farmington Hills, Mich., and the other in Irvine, Calif.
